
在大数据时代,爬虫工作也变得尤为重要,特别是对于亟需转型的传统企业和急待发展的中小企业而言,应如何从庞大的数据中整理出自己所需要的数据?下面我们来谈谈一些爬虫在工作过程中可能遇到的一些问题。
1、经常更新网页。
网上的信息总是不断地更新,因此,我们在工作信息时,需要定期地对其进行操作,也就是要设定工作信息的时间间隔,以免工作网站的服务器更新,而我们所做的就是不努力。
2、一些网站禁止爬虫工具。
有些网站为了防止某些恶意工作,会设置防工作程序,你会发现明明很多数据显示在浏览器上,但却收不到。
3、混乱问题。
虽然我们成功地抓到网页信息后,也无法顺利地进行数据分析,很多时候我们工作网页信息后,会发现我们工作的信息都乱码了。
4、分析资料。
事实上,到了这个阶段,基本上我们的工作已经取得了很大的成功,不过数据分析的工作量是非常大的,要完成大规模的数据分析还需要花费大量的时间。
所以,当我们真正遇到这些问题时,我们应该怎么做?
第一我们需要理解,爬虫工作要在合法的范围内进行,可以借鉴他人的各种数据和信息,但不要原样照搬,毕竟别人辛辛苦苦做数据写各种资料也很难。毫无疑问,爬虫工作需要一个能够正确运行的程序来支持,如果能够自己写出最好的,如果不能,网上会有许多教程和源代码,不过,后来出现的实际问题还是需要您自己来操作,例如:浏览器显示的信息,但我们抓到后却无法正常显示,此时我们要看http头信息,要分析一下选择什么样的压缩方式,还需要后期自己挑选一些实用的解析工具,对没有技术经验的人来说,确实非常困难。